@ud-viz/widget_legonizer is a tool designed to generate Lego mockups based on user-defined coordinates and scales. It offers functionality for creating and manipulating Lego models within a 3D view.

Usage#

Features:

  • Coordinates Input: Allows users to specify the position, rotation, and scale of the Lego model.
  • Scale Parameters: Provides options to adjust the accuracy of the heightmap and specify the number of Lego plates to be used in the mockup.
    • Ratio: Scale of the mockup (WIP)
    • Count Lego: Size of the lego model required in plate, based on 32x32 stud baseplate.
  • Area Selection: Enables users to define a rectangular area in the 3D view for generating Lego mockups.
  • Generate Mockup: Generates a Lego mockup based on the selected area and parameters provided by the user.
  • Visualize Mockup: Provides a visual representation of the generated Lego mockup.

Implementation:

To use the Legonizer, follow these steps:

  1. Import the required modules:
CODE
import { PlanarView } from 'itowns'
import { Legonizer } from '@ud-viz/legonizer'
  1. Initialize the Legonizer with a PlanarView:
CODE
const view = new PlanarView(viewerDiv, extent);
const legonizer = new Legonizer(view);
